Overview Abm 500mg Injection
The antibiotic Abm 500mg Injection combats diverse bacterial infections, encompassing urinary tract, bone, joint, lung (pneumonia), brain, and bloodstream infections. Prophylactic use is also common in hospitalized individuals. Its mechanism involves bacterial growth inhibition. Administered intravenously (drip) or by intramuscular/intravenous injection by a healthcare professional only, it requires adherence to a regular, evenly-spaced dosage schedule as directed. Complete the prescribed course; premature discontinuation risks relapse or infection exacerbation. Typical side effects involve injection site reactions and elevated blood urea. Persistent side effects or treatment inefficacy warrant consultation. High doses may induce disequilibrium, renal impairment, and hearing deficits; therefore, strict adherence to medical guidance is vital, including potential monitoring via kidney function, hearing, and urine tests. Pregnancy contraindicates its use; disclose pregnancy, pregnancy planning, or breastfeeding to your physician.

How Abm 500mg Injection works:
The injectable antibiotic Abm 500mg halts bacterial proliferation by inhibiting the production of proteins crucial for bacterial survival.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holSAFE
Ingestion of alcohol alongside a 500mg Abm injection presents no known adverse reactions.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Administering Abm 500mg Injection during pregnancy poses a confirmed risk to fetal development and is therefore inadvisable. Exceptions may exist in critical medical emergencies where a physician deems the potential benefits outweigh the inherent dangers. Physician consultation is essential.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Administering Abm 500mg Injection while breastfeeding is considered safe. Research in humans indicates negligible transfer of the medication into breast milk, posing no known risk to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
Administering Abm 500mg Injection may induce drowsiness, blurred vision, and dizziness, potentially impairing alertness. Driving should be avoided if these effects manifest.
KidneyCAUTION
For individuals with kidney impairment, the administration of Abm 500mg Injection requires careful monitoring. A modified dosage of Abm 500mg Injection might be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
LiverS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
The use of Abm 500mg Injection in individuals with liver impairment is likely safe. Current evidence indicates dose modification may not be necessary, but physician consultation is recommended.
